Join New Music Detroit as we celebrate 19 years of strange and beautiful music in the Motor City. This year's theme, 'AFTERIMAGE', traces the meaning that emerges through the resonance and reverberation of listening together.
The 2026 lineup is a convergence of radically different sonic spheres: a rare performance of Philip Glass's monumental 1971 work "Music With Changing Parts"; perspectives on disability and asymmetry as told through the body and voice; ambient dreamscapes; ancestral memory shaped by air into sound; beat-driven electronics, jazz-inflected and rooted in Detroit's own cultural soil; and even performance that removes the "instrument" altogether.
